def where(collection, properties): """Examines each element in a collection, returning an array of all elements that have the given properties. Args: collection (list|dict): Collection to iterate over. properties (dict): property values to filter by Returns: list: filtered list. Example: >>> results = where([{'a': 1}, {'b': 2}, {'a': 1, 'b': 3}], {'a': 1}) >>> assert results == [{'a': 1}, {'a': 1, 'b': 3}] .. versionadded:: 1.0.0 """ return filter_(collection, pyd.matches(properties))
